– 1 roll of puff pastry dough – 2 cup of pecan pieces – 1 egg – 1 (14 oz) can of condensed milk, sweetened – 1 cup of light Karo Syrup – 1 tsp vanilla extract – 1/2 tsp of salt

Ingredients:

Mix the pecan pie filling: egg, condensed milk, Karo Syrup, vanilla extract and salt. Once these have been mixed well, fold in the pecan pieces and set aside.

STEP ONE

Prep the puff pastry crusts. Roll out the puff pastry dough onto parchment paper, and cut 12 rounds using a 3 1/2" biscuit cutter.

STEP TWO

Pierce each round several times using a fork. Then place each puff pastry round into a muffin cup and press down to make sure there is no air between the puff pastry and the muffin cup.

STEP THREE

Add 1 tablespoon of the pecan pie filling into the center of each puff pastry round

STEP FOUR

Bake at 350 for 16 minutes or until the puff pastry starts to brown.

STEP FIVE

Remove for the oven and allow the pecan pie puff bites to completely cool before enjoying!
